  • Abstract
    This article compares the closed loop performances that can be achieved by the reported PI tuning methods for integrating first order plus time delay process models. An attempt has been made to help the user in selecting the tuning method for servo and regulatory control purposes. The measures used for comparison are the integral of squared error in the controlled variable and the total variation of the manipulated variable. The maximum sensitivity is used to estimate the robustness of the control system.
